7. If you are moving the product on the stand, do the following:
• Close the paper basket.
• Release the caster locks.
• Move the product on an even floor surface.
• Lock the casters in the new location.
Caution: Do not move the product with locked casters. Avoid areas with steps or uneven flooring.
Note: If you are transporting or storing the product below 14°F (–10°C), you must discharge the ink.
See the link below for instructions.
8. If you are transporting the product, place it in its original packing materials, if possible, or use
equivalent materials with cushioning around the product.
9. After the printer is moved, connect the power cable and turn on the printer.
10. Run a print head nozzle check and clean the print head, if necessary.

Discharging Ink
If you need to move or transport your product when the temperature is 14°F (–10°C) or lower, you must
first discharge the ink to keep the print head in optimum condition.
Note: The maintenance box needs enough capacity to discharge the ink. Replace the maintenance box
first if the remaining capacity is low.
1. Turn on the product.
2. Remove all the paper from the product.
3. Press the
4. Select Settings > Maintenance > Discharging/Charging Ink > Start.
